Apple’s folding iPad or MacBook: What to expect, and when it will ship



Though Apple has yet to introduce a product with a folding display, the rumor mill believes the technology will make its way to the iPad and MacBook. Here’s what to expect, and when to expect it.

Foldable device displaying scenic landscape on a desk. Nearby are a small plant, wireless mouse, and cat-shaped lamp in a soft, warm lighting setting.
Apple’s super-sized foldable iPad could arrive with a high price point, due to complex hinge and panel designs.

Over the years, we’ve heard various claims surrounding Apple’s foldable display ideas, most of which have to do with a supposed iPhone Fold that’s said to be in the works. The iPhone will likely receive the technology first, so it only makes sense that the iPad and MacBook would follow suit.

The idea itself is not far-fetched, with Apple’s own patents indicating that the company was at least considering a foldable iPad-type device at one point. More recently, however, leakers and analysts alike have all chimed in with claims of technical specifications and supposed release dates, and they have a lot to say.
